CA DMV CDL Air Brakes Practice Test Flashcards Which of the following will be true about your brake function if your ABS fails?(A) It will slow your truck to a halt and force you to pull over.(B) You will sill have normal brake function and will just need to get the ABS repaired soon(C) You will have no brake function, and the truck will be out of control(D) It may cause problems with other mechanical systems and possibly pose a huge fire risk.(B) You will sill have normal brake function and will just need to get the ABS repaired soon Which vehicles must have low air pressure warning signals?(A) All vehicles with air brakes currently in operation(B) None(C) Only those built after 2005(D) Only those built after 2010 (A) All vehicles with air brakes currently in operation An anti-lock braking system (ABS)(A) increases your normal baking capability(B) activates when the wheels are about to lock up(C) decreases your normal capability(D) shortens your stopping distance.(B) activates when the wheels are about to lock up When should you use the parking brake?(A) Only in urban areas where there are many other vehicles(B) Every time you leave your vehicles for any period of time(C) Only if you are away from your vehicle for an extended period of time.(D) Every time you leave your vehicle, with rare exceptions (D) Every time you leave your vehicle, with rare exceptions Spring brakes are(A) brakes that come automatically on a trick or tractor when the psi drops too low(B) not going to take full effect until your psi drops to a certain range, often 20 to 30 psi(C) made up of powerful springs that are held back by air pressure while you are driving(D) all of the above (D) all of the above Which of the following is NOT part of the braking process when driving a tractor-trailer combination vehicle with an anti-lock braking system (ABS)?(A) Brake the same way no

matter what you're driving: a vehicle with ABS, a vehicle

with a trailer, or something else(B) when you slow down, you should monitor your tractor and trailer and ease off the brakes to keep control(C) You should drive more quickly so that you will be able to keep the trailer and tractor straight(D) You should use only the braking necessary to stay safely in control.(C) You should drive more quickly so that you will be able to keep the trailer and tractor straight Why must you study air brakes in the state of California?(A) All trucks have air brakes in California(B) Otherwise, you will have to get a CDL with restrictions(C) Otherwise, you cannot get a CDL at all(D) Otherwise, you cannot get a

CDL permit (B) Otherwise, you will have to get a CDL with restrictions Which of the following is NOT part of the drum brake?(A) Brake drum(B) Slack adjuster(C) Safety valve(D) Return spring (C) Safety valve

How would you check your truck's slack adjusters?(A) Press the brake pedal while listening for any strange noises(B) Use gloves and pull hard on each slack adjuster you can reach.(C) Accelerate and then brake hard(D) All of the above are correct (B) Use gloves and pull hard on each slack adjuster you can reach.Why must air brakes be drained?(A) Your brakes may fail because of water freezing(B) You will drive too quickly if they are not(C) Your transmission fluid may drain out(D) Your left-side bake will cease to operate (A) Your air brakes may fail because of water freezing When should you drain your air tanks?(A) At the end of the month(B) At the end of the fiscal quarter(C) At the end of a trip(D) At the end of each working day (D) At the end of each working day How can you tell if your vehicle is equipped with an anti-lock braking system (ABS)?(A) The vehicle was manufactured after 2010(B) The vehicle was manufactured after 1998(C) ABS is still optional(D) The vehicle was manufactured after 2000 (B) The vehicle was manufactured after 1998 Which of the following should you do before leaving your vehicle unattended?(A) Put on the parking brakes(B) Chock the wheels(C) Remove the keys(D) Do all of the above (D) Do all of the above The tractor protection valve(A) closes if you apply the parking brakes(B) provides the air supply for the brake system(C) will close itself automatically if the air supply drops a certain level(D) does all of the above (D) does all of the above What is the best way to test your vehicle's low air pressure warning signal?(A) Pump the brakes while your vehicle is fully on.(B) Pump the brakes until the air pressure drops below 30 psi(C) Manually let the air out of your brakes and see if the signal comes on.(D) With the engine off, step on and off the brake pedal to lower the air pressure below 60 psi.(D) With the engine off, step on and off the brake pedal to lower the air pressure below 60 psi The purpose of a supply pressure gauge is(A) to warn you if there is too little air in the tank(B) to tell you how hot the air in the tank is(C) to tell you how much air is in the tank(D) to do all of the above (C) to tell you how much air is in the tank How do brakes work on a long, steep downgrade?(A) They work as the main braking mechanism, with the engine braking effect as an emergency backup(B) Not applicable; no braking effect is involved in a down a downgrade(C) They work as a supplement to the braking effect of your engine(D) They work as the main braking mechanism (C) They work as a supplement to the braking effect of your engine Which of the following is true about a dual air brake system?(A) Usually, one system operates the front axle and the other system operates the rear axle.(B) One
